During the warm spring and summer months, groups of Jamestown Engine Plant (JEP) employees step away from the engine assembly line and into the Giving Garden. Crisp zucchini, zesty peppers and tangy onions are just a few of the vegetables growing in the Giving' Garden's 16 vegetable beds. The vegetables are harvested and donated to St. Susan Center, a local soup kitchen in Jamestown, New York.
